An initial damage deposit of $50.00 shall be paid by each competitor at registration, unless extended by the OA. This deposit is the maximum insurance deductible payable by a competitor as a result of any one incident. During the camp, in the case of contact, damages will be split between the competitors involved, unless fault is assigned to just some of the competitors by the OA. b. In the event of a deduction from the damage deposit the OA may require that the deposit be restored to its original amount before the competitor will be permitted to continue in the event. c. Any remaining deposit after the event will be refunded within 30 days after the event. 7. RULES a. The event will be governed by The Racing Rules of Sailing, including Appendix C. b. The rules for the handling of boats will apply to the clinic and regatta. Class rules will not apply. c. The prescriptions to rules 60, 63.2 and 63.4 do not apply. d. Add to RRS 41: (e) help to recover from the water and return on board a crew member, provided the return on board is at the approximate location of the recovery. 8. BOATS AND SAILS a. The event will be sailed in Sonar type sailboats. b. The following sails will be provided for each boat: Mainsail, Jib, and Spinnaker. c. Boats will be allocated by draw, either daily or for each round as decided by the Race Committee. 9. CREW (INCLUDING SKIPPER) a. The number of crew (including skipper) shall be three or four (3-4). A crew will race all races with the same number of crew as sailed in the first race, unless instructed to do otherwise by the OA. b. The maximum crew weight, determined prior to racing shall be 772 pounds per boat. 10. EVENT FORMAT a. The event will consist of the following stages: Stage 1: Single Round Robin. Stage 2: Single Round Robin.
b. The OA may change the format, terminate or eliminate any round when conditions do not permit the completion of the intended format. 11. COURSE a. The course will be windward/leeward/windward/leeward with starboard roundings, finishing downwind. 12. ADVERTISING a. As boats and equipment will be supplied by the OA, ISAF Regulation 20.4 applies.
